Here's my opinion:

Factory Windscreen- comes with 2001 US models so you would be set if you are in the States. getting a windscreen of anysort makes the ride more enjoyable. Option 1 is to get the factory mod and Rick's 7/8 replacement. Option 2 is Mingster at Improt Development has a nice ready-to install screen that works great too.

Rear Spoiler, side strakes, and front lip- depends on if you like that look. If you like it, you can either get it with the car, or look online here and see if the site sponsors have a better price (which I believe they do)

Floormats- Wait and get the Muz 3 piece Floor mats which do NOT require that the carpet be cut in any way. Stock mats require the dealer cut through the carpet for a mounting bracket.

None of the factory options are a must, all of them, as the name tells, are only options.

The must have are:
Muz Top well Mat. To prevent scratches on the inner aspect of the vynil window when the top is down.
Muz 1 piece floor mats (the factory mats do not do a good job protecting all the carpet).
Rear window bolster or a big towel, to protect the vinyl window from creasing or scratching when rubbing agaist itself once the top is down.
The wind deflector is a must, but fortunatly is standard in the '01 models. If you are getting a used Stook ('00 model), you will need one of these.

The rest, are only options you can live without.
